6 Shelf life enhancement of papaya by edible coating Edible coating solution can be prepared from carboxy methyl cellulose or hydroxyl propyl methyl cellulose and can be used to increase the post harvest quality of papaya

9 Antioxidant enrichment of strawberry by phenol rich edible coating solution Edible coating solution can be prepared from carboxy methyl cellulose or hydroxyl propyl methyl cellulose by addition of phenols extracted from the pomegranate peels or other sources and can be used to increase the post harvest quality of peach. Phenols extracted have antibacterial and antifungal activity.
